What Actually Is Emergency Chiropractic Treatment?

Emergency chiropractic refers to immediate, unscheduled chiropractic evaluation and treatment for sudden musculoskeletal trauma. Unlike routine chiropractic visits that focus on chronic or long-term conditions, emergency chiropractic centers on addressing the body after a traumatic event so that inflammation, soft tissue damage escalate. Time is critical — the sooner a trained chiropractor examines a fresh trauma, the better the outcome.

Mechanically, emergency chiropractic operates through restoring proper alignment to the skeletal and supporting tissues. When a fall disrupts the spine, vertebrae can shift out of optimal alignment, irritating the surrounding tissues that radiate outward from the central column. A experienced chiropractor delivers controlled manual adjustments to restore normal spinal mechanics and lower inflammatory pressure.

The methods used in emergency chiropractic may include spinal manipulation, myofascial release, cervical traction, and corrective movement protocols. Our providers at East Coast Injury Clinic select the most effective technique guided by the nature of your condition and your overall medical history. Each emergency patients receive a one-size-fits-all approach — intervention is always customized.

The Emergency Chiropractic Procedure Step by Step

  1. Emergency Arrival and Check-In — When you come into our office, our intake team expedites your check-in to minimize wait time. You'll concisely share the circumstances of your injury, when symptoms began, and your immediate areas of concern. Timeliness at this phase guarantees the clinician has the information needed to begin the assessment without delay.
  2. Acute Assessment — A credentialed chiropractor conducts a comprehensive physical and neurological examination. This includes evaluating the vertebral column, testing flexibility, and identifying regions with tenderness. When warranted, digital X-rays may be taken immediately to screen for fractures before manual treatment is initiated.
  3. Clinical Findings and Care — Based on the examination findings, your doctor establishes the precise injuries contributing to your pain and reviews a transparent clinical strategy. The diagnosis phase makes certain you are aware of what tissues are involved and what every intervention is intended to accomplish.
  4. Hands-On Treatment — The core of emergency chiropractic treatment is the chiropractic adjustment. Using precise pressure, the chiropractor corrects displaced spinal levels to their intended orientation. According to your injury profile, this may involve neck manipulation, mid-back therapy, low-back adjustment, or multiple regions thereof.
  5. Supportive Manual Therapies — Following the joint correction, your chiropractor may apply soft tissue modalities such as therapeutic massage, ultrasound therapy, or cryotherapy to reduce residual spasm and enhance the healing process.
  6. At-Home Recovery — Before you head home, your chiropractor gives detailed at-home recovery protocols. These commonly cover heat versus cold application, movement modifications, positional recommendations, and gentle stretches that help reinforce the corrections made during your emergency visit.
  7. Ongoing Treatment Planning — Emergency chiropractic often benefits from a brief course of additional appointments to fully resolve the initial episode. Your provider arranges additional appointments before you walk out, so that continuity is established from the very start.

Who Is a Good Candidate for Emergency Chiropractic Treatment?

Emergency chiropractic works well for a broad spectrum of individuals. Those who frequently respond get more info well include patients of car crashes experiencing whiplash, head and neck discomfort, or lower back pain. On-the-job trauma cases — particularly those in labor-intensive jobs — also benefit from immediate emergency chiropractic evaluation. Likewise, active individuals who sustain severe spinal trauma mid-season frequently turn to emergency chiropractic services to avoid prolonged downtime.

People experiencing acute disc bulges, severe sciatic radiculopathy, costovertebral joint dysfunction, or post-accident stiffness are all well-suited patients for emergency chiropractic services. It's worth noting that, certain patients is the right match. Those presenting active fractures may require orthopedic evaluation before chiropractic care can be initiated. Our providers always assess for conditions requiring medical referral during the first assessment.

People who are pregnant, those with particular cardiovascular conditions, or those already being treated for serious neurological disorders should mention their full medical history prior to receiving emergency chiropractic treatment. Open communication from the patient and chiropractor ensures that every treatment decision is made with your best interest as the primary priority.

Emergency Chiropractic Common Questions Answered

How much time does an emergency chiropractic session last?

A initial emergency chiropractic session usually takes between 45 minutes to just over an hour, depending on the scope of your condition. This includes registration, the orthopedic and neurological examination, any imaging, and the hands-on adjustment itself. Subsequent emergency chiropractic appointments often take less time as your provider already is familiar with your injury.

Are chiropractic adjustments uncomfortable?

The majority of individuals say that emergency chiropractic care result in very little discomfort during the appointment itself. Some individuals feel mild post-treatment stiffness — much like how you feel after a physical training. This usually clears within one to two hours. Our clinical team use gentle pressure tailored to your specific comfort threshold.

How soon will I notice results from emergency chiropractic treatment?

Many patients experience meaningful pain relief immediately following their first emergency chiropractic session. Full resolution is influenced by the type of the injury, your physical baseline, and whether you follow your prescribed treatment plan. Newly sustained injuries addressed without delay through emergency chiropractic usually improve more quickly than injuries that have been ignored.

Is it wise to delay emergency chiropractic after a car collision?

Putting off emergency chiropractic treatment after a car accident is a frequently observed mistakes accident patients make. Post-accident adrenaline can mask serious pain for up to 48 hours post-accident. Seeking emergency chiropractic assessment no more than 72 hours we consistently advise — both for your health outcomes and to protect any ongoing legal or insurance claims.
